Skiing in Park City Utah. After always skiing on ice in the East, it was so great to be on powder in the beautiful Wasatch Mountains. We rented a condo, so we did some home-cooked, relaxed meals. Park City has a wonderful shuttle bus system (free) that the boys (age 18) could ride and go downtown or to another resort. It was the year after the Olympics and we got to see the ski jumps, bob sled runs, etc. We also drove into Salt Lake and saw the Jazz play basketball.

My son's best friend, who went with us, is still talking about the trip 7 years later. And he has traveled all over this country and Europe.

It was just perfect.
